Output f31d3e7f6833ed47342c904410ca2a5e73ea8e1c98a7866243a0ec18fbaf317d:1

value
37517354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c79e957193b051bc3797567305b3b232bfa7bda OP_EQUAL
address
3D3BktXbNrkVjCz4HoM3HG2NAiq1BFjxiC
transaction
f31d3e7f6833ed47342c904410ca2a5e73ea8e1c98a7866243a0ec18fbaf317d
confirmations
349379
spent
true